The Polish Lowland Sheepdog, also known as the PON, is a breed that originated in Poland and was traditionally used as a herding dog. With a long, shaggy coat and intelligent demeanor, the PON is known for its ability to work independently and make quick decisions in the field.
In contrast, the Bullmastiff is a breed that was originally developed in England as a guard dog for large estates. With a powerful build and protective instincts, the Bullmastiff is known for its loyalty and courage in protecting its family.

The Polish Lowland Sheepdog and Bullmastiff mix is a medium to large-sized dog with a sturdy build and a dense, double coat. The coat can vary in length and texture, depending on whether the dog inherits more of the PON's shaggy coat or the Bullmastiff's short, smooth coat.
These dogs typically have a square-shaped head with a strong jaw and alert expression. The ears are usually floppy and the tail is long and carried low. The color of the coat can range from black and white to fawn or brindle, with or without white markings.
One of the most appealing traits of the Polish Lowland Sheepdog and Bullmastiff mix is its loyal and protective nature. These dogs are known for their strong bond with their families and their willingness to protect them from any potential threats.
They are also intelligent and eager to please, making them easy to train and quick learners. However, they can be independent and stubborn at times, so consistent training and socialization are important to ensure a well-behaved pet.
Despite their protective instincts, these dogs are generally friendly and sociable with strangers, making them great family pets and good with children. They are also good with other animals, especially if they are raised together from a young age.
Due to their herding and guarding backgrounds, the Polish Lowland Sheepdog and Bullmastiff mix is an active and energetic breed that requires plenty of exercise and mental stimulation. Daily walks, playtime, and obedience training are essential to keep these dogs happy and healthy.
Training should start at an early age and be consistent and positive. These dogs respond well to praise and rewards, so using positive reinforcement techniques is recommended. They can excel in obedience, agility, and even herding trials, thanks to their intelligence and drive to work.
Like all dogs, the Polish Lowland Sheepdog and Bullmastiff mix is prone to certain health issues that are common in both parent breeds. These may include hip dysplasia, eye problems, and skin allergies.
To ensure the health and well-being of your dog, regular vet check-ups, a balanced diet, and plenty of exercise are important. Grooming needs will vary depending on the length and texture of the coat, but regular brushing and baths are typically all that is needed to keep these dogs looking their best.
